The Truth About Baby Layettes


Introduction


At a recent baby shower for a friend expecting her first child, it became clear that many of us?"mostly college friends without kids?"weren't familiar with some essential baby items. One such item, the "baby layette," might be unfamiliar to new parents or those who enjoy having a checklist for preparation. Here’s a guide to help expecting parents gather the essential items needed for their new arrival.

Essential Clothing and Daily Items


It's crucial to have four to six of each basic item your baby will need daily. This includes:

- Undershirts
- Sleeping gowns
- Onesies
- Footsie pajamas
- Receiving blankets
- Hooded towels
- Socks
- Washcloths
- Daily clothing

These essentials help manage the increased laundry demands, ensuring you're never caught without a clean outfit.

Bringing Baby Home


The going-home outfit is significant, as it will be the first time many friends and family meet your baby. This moment is rich with sentiment and likely to be captured in many photos.

Nursery Must-Haves


For the nursery, consider these essentials:

- Crib or Bassinet: Opt for one with adjustable settings to accommodate your growing baby.
- Bedding: Stock up on two to four crib or bassinette sheets, a crib bumper, and two to three crib blankets. Adding a dust ruffle and waterproof pads can be useful as well.
- Playpen: Handy for visits to friends, family gatherings, or simply moving from room to room.

Clothes and Diapers


While accumulating clothes, focus on sizes three to six months to accommodate a rapidly growing baby. Keep at least one large box of newborn-sized diapers on hand initially, but be cautious not to overstock in case your baby quickly outgrows them.

Bath and Changing Essentials


Prepare for bathing and changing with:

- Baby shampoo: Two to three bottles
- Baby oil and lotion
- Baby powder: Cornstarch is an effective alternative
- Zinc oxide: For diaper rash

If you're breastfeeding, it's still wise to have 6-12 bottles with nipples and collars, plus spare nipples if needed.

Conclusion


While this list may seem extensive, having these essentials ready will ease the transition into parenthood, ensuring you’re well-prepared for your new journey.
